Starbucks drops four secret menu drinks inspired by ‘The Devil Wears Prada’ — only available through the app

The Devil Drinks Starbucks.

Starbucks launched a secret menu to celebrate “The Devil Wears Prada 2,” which hits theaters May 1.

The coffee giant is introducing a curated lineup of beverages inspired by the characters of the highly anticipated sequel, which are available exclusively in the Starbucks app.

Each beverage is meant to reflect the personalities of the cast fans know and love from the original 2006 film: Miranda Priestly (Meryl Streep), Andrea “Andy” Sachs (Anne Hathaway), Nigel Kipling (Stanley Tucci) and Emily Charlton (Emily Blunt).

“The Devil Wears Prada 2” Secret Menu features Miranda’s Signature Order, which is a no-foam, extra-shot, extra-hot Caffè Latte with nonfat milk, “because anything less would prompt … questions,” the press release reads.

And as we know, Miranda Priestly would like her Starbucks waiting.

Andy’s Cappuccino is an oatmilk Cappuccino with caramel and cinnamon — “simple, elevated, and ready to walk the line between who she was and who she’s becoming.”

“Gird your loins…” reads the description for Nigel’s Go-to Doppio, quoting Tucci’s character in the first film. Nigel’s “bold and refined” drink is a Doppio Espresso Con Panna with mocha sauce.

Lastly, Emily’s Fave Iced Chai is an Iced Chai Latte with almond milk and sugar-free caramel, “fussy, with every sip enjoyed at a glacial pace… or not,” the description said, calling back to a Miranda Priestly quote in the first film.

“By all means, move at a glacial pace. You know how that thrills me,” Priestly said in the iconic line.

“Starbucks has been part of The Devil Wears Prada universe since the original film,” Erin Silvoy, senior vice president of global marketing at Starbucks, said in a statement.

“We’re excited to bring that connection to life again, giving fans a way to step into the moment – starting with their daily coffee.”

The beverages will be available for a limited time in participating stores around the world.

The secret menu is just part of Starbucks’ broader collaboration with “The Devil Wears Prada 2.” Starting April 24, the Starbucks Reserve location in the Empire State Building in New York City will be offering copies of the limited-edition promotional “Runway Magazine,” the publication Miranda Priestly runs.

“It’s all good energy with Starbucks and our new movie, ‘The Devil Wears Prada 2,’” Lylle Breier, EVP, Partnerships, Promotions, Synergy & Events at Disney, said.

“We are thrilled to be collaborating in such a big way with Starbucks on a bold, clever, and thematic global program designed to delight fans around the world.”
